Ended up using "Liquid Leaf". Came across it whilst researching how best to apply gold leaf; its basically tiny fragments of the stuff suspended in a liquid that evaporates after a few seconds on contact with air. Paint it on with soft brush, leave it to dry then gently buff with a soft cloth or cotton wool. Works really well.
